China Deploys Humanoid Robots in Public Spaces

China has officially begun deploying humanoid robots in public spaces, marking a significant step in the integration of advanced robotics into everyday life. The robots are being utilized in a capacity that facilitates public interaction and service.

Robot Capabilities and Deployment

The deployed robots are designed to perform tasks that involve direct interaction with the public. Initial deployments have seen these robots assisting in environments where they can engage with people, suggesting a focus on service-oriented roles. The specific functions and range of capabilities of these humanoid robots are still being assessed, but their presence indicates a move towards practical applications of humanoid technology beyond research and development.
